Google’s latest release, Gemini 2.5, is not just another model update. According to the company, it’s a leap forward in terms of intelligence per dollar, making it more accessible for developers and businesses alike. The model is designed to be more efficient, allowing for faster and cheaper deployment of AI solutions. This is a game-changer for industries looking to integrate AI into their operations.
DeepMind’s AlphaGenome is another groundbreaking development. The model can read 1 million DNA base pairs in a single pass, a feat that could revolutionize genomics and personalized medicine. By analyzing genetic data at unprecedented speeds, AlphaGenome opens the door to new discoveries in health and disease.
Meanwhile, GitHub Spark is democratizing software development. By allowing users to build applications from simple prompts, GitHub is making it easier for non-developers to create software. This could lead to a surge in innovation as more people gain access to the tools needed to bring their ideas to life.
